What is the difference between Operations Job vs Supply Chain Coordinator?

AspectOperations JobSupply Chain Coordinator
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require certifications in operations or logisticsHigh school diploma; certifications in supply chain or logistics are common
Work EnvironmentManufacturing, warehousing, or office settings; focus on process managementLogistics centers, warehouses, or offices; focus on supply chain processes
Employer & Industry UsageManufacturing, retail, logistics companiesRetail, manufacturing, distribution companies
Common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ding operational roles and responsibilitiesManaging supply chain activities and coordination

Operations Jobs focus on managing daily processes, production, and overall efficiency within a company. Supply Chain Coordinators specifically handle the logistics, procurement, and coordination of goods movement. While both roles involve logistics and process management, Operations Jobs have a broader scope, whereas Supply Chain Coordinators specialize in supply chain activities.

Is operations a high paying job?

Operations jobs can offer competitive salaries, especially in management or specialized roles such as operations managers or supply chain directors. Compensation varies based on industry, experience, location, and company size, with higher-paying positions often requiring leadership skills and relevant certifications.

What do operations careers do?

Operations careers involve managing and coordinating daily business activities to ensure efficiency and productivity. Roles may include supply chain management, process improvement, logistics, and overseeing staff, often requiring skills in organization, problem-solving, and familiarity with tools like ERP systems.

What is an operations job role?

An operations job role involves managing and coordinating daily business activities to ensure efficiency and productivity. It often includes tasks such as process improvement, resource allocation, and overseeing teams, with skills in organization, communication, and problem-solving essential for success.

What jobs are in operations?

Operations jobs include roles such as operations manager, logistics coordinator, supply chain analyst, warehouse supervisor, and production planner. These positions focus on managing processes, optimizing efficiency, and ensuring smooth business functions, often requiring skills in project management, problem-solving, and familiarity with tools like ERP systems.

Job description

This position is pending contract award.  If AAR is awarded this contract, the estimated start date is October 1, 2026.

Description:  

The Aviation Operations Manager supports the U.S. Army's Initial Entry RotaryWing (IERW) training mission as part of a contractor operated FSN program. This role manages daily aviation operational activities required under the contract, ensuring safe, compliant, and efficient execution of flight operations. The manager coordinates mission planning, aircrew scheduling, flight tracker, regulatory compliance, and operational reporting while maintaining seamless integration with Army Aviation procedures, FSN contract requirements, and government oversight.

What you will be responsible for:  

  • Execute aviation operational functions in support of FSN contract requirements, including flight scheduling, mission planning, aircrew assignments, and resource coordination.
  • Ensure all contractor aviation operations comply with DoD, FAA, Army Aviation, and company policies, procedures, and safety standards.
  • Serve as the primary operational liaison between the contractor, the FSN government customer, Army Aviation units, and supporting organizations.
  • Implement and maintain operational risk management processes, including hazard identification, mitigation strategies, and safety documentation required under the FSN contract.
  • Oversee aircrew qualification tracking, training schedules, and currency requirements to maintain compliance with IERW training standards and contract deliverables.
  • Develop, update, and enforce contractor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) aligned with Army Aviation doctrine and FSN program requirements.
  • Prepare operational reports, metrics, and documentation required by the FSN government customer, audits, and contract oversight bodies.
  • Support incident/accident response, reporting, and investigation activities in accordance with contract and regulatory requirements.
  • Provide leadership and supervision to operational personnel, ensuring performance standards and FSN contract deliverables are met.
  • Assist with operational budget planning, resource forecasting, and procurement activities related to aviation operations under the FSN program.
  • Perform other duties as assigned. 

What you will need to be successful in this role:   

  • In order to access Fort Rucker, US Citizenship is required.
  • Prior DoD aviation operations experience (Army Aviation preferred; Air Force or Naval Aviation acceptable).
  • Strong knowledge of military aviation procedures, mission planning, aircrew management, and operational risk management.
  • Experience supporting or operating within a government aviation training contract.
  • Proficiency with aviation scheduling systems, flight operations software, and missiontracking tools.
  • Ability to coordinate effectively with Army Aviation units, government agencies, and contracted aviation organizations.
  • Understanding of FAA regulations applicable to government or military aviation operations.
  • Strong communication, leadership, and decisionmaking skills.
  • Bachelor's degree in Aviation Management, Aeronautics, or related field; equivalent military experience may be considered.
  • Experience with Safety Management Systems (SMS) and aviation quality assurance programs.
  • To access the Fort Rucker site, US citizenship is required.
